Waiata whakanui is a term in te reo Māori that translates to "celebratory song" or "song of praise." It refers to songs sung to celebrate, honor, or show appreciation for individuals, events, or achievements in Māori culture. These songs are important for expressing gratitude, acknowledging accomplishments, and strengthening community connections.
